Merrimack College is a private Augustinian Catholic college located just north of Boston, Mass., and is home to a close-knit community of 3,250 undergraduate students from 34 states and 28 countries. Established as a response to the needs of local soldiers returning from World War II, Merrimack College, situated near Boston, has graduated over 27,000 students since the time it was founded.
